I’m a wedding planner, the ten mistakes brides make a week before their big day

A WEDDING PLANNER has revealed the ten most common mistakes couples make when counting down to their expected big day.
Tania, who designs and plans modern weddings across the UK, has been covering the latest countdown on her TikTok account @hireesocieties.

In a video on what not to do a week before your wedding, Tania revealed the biggest mistakes and how to fix them.
Speaking directly to the camera and her followers, the wedding planner said: “So you’re not sure what to do a week before the wedding – well I’ll tell you.
“For those who don’t know me, I’m Tania and I’m a British, World Award Winning Wedding Planner.
“And I’m here to help and give you tips and tricks and really have some fun on TikTok.”


Then, Tania lifted the lid as she recalled moments throughout her career when she’d seen brides and grooms make the same mistakes over and over — especially when it came to beauty treatments.
“So the first thing I would say is please avoid any face waxing or face threading before your wedding.”
However, she added a caveat: “If you don’t always do it and you know your skin then great, let’s do it.”
Tania’s second piece of advice was not to sign up for a spray tan or tanning treatment either.
She continued, “Again, I would avoid spray tanning unless you do it all the time.
“First, it really shows in your photos, and second, you don’t want brown stains on your suits or dresses, whatever you’re wearing.”
Tania then said she suggested that people shouldn’t get facials or experiment with new skin products so close to the ceremony.
She continued, “Again, you don’t want your skin to react to the new products you’re going to use and you want to keep it clean. So stick to your old routine.”

The fourth thing Tania had seen was people having their hair completely restyled or colored.
While Tania’s fifth tip was don’t start a new exercise routine that you aren’t used to, as you may be pulling or straining a muscle.
The same applies to a crash diet. Tania continued: “Nobody has to go on a diet anyway because you’re beautiful the way you are.
“But if you want to go on a diet before your wedding, please see a professional.”
Tania’s final no-gos are not getting a photographer the night before, not arguing with anyone for the past seven days.
She also said that many don’t take the time to stop to properly enjoy the preparation and that the tenth and final thing that should be banned is last minute changes to the wedding.
